Question:
I have a 2020 Chevy Silverado with the 6 cyl diesel engine. I tow a travel trailer that is 5200lb base weight ... probably 6000lb loaded. Also, I am using a load equalizing hitch, but the front end will porpoise a bit on bumps. Looking at Timbren TGMRCK15S or SumoSprings SS45FR. There is a huge weight capacity difference between these two 7100 lb. With my set up which do you recommend? Or do you recommend another product?
asked by: Rick M
Helpful Expert Reply:
Suspension enhancement may help you, but first I would make sure that your Weight Distribution system is rated and set up correctly. If it is, then you can go with some sort of suspension enhancement. Both the Timbren # TGMRCK15S and the SumoSprings # SS45FR are rated enough for your rig. The biggest comparison of the Sumos and Timbrens is how stiff and rigid they are when unloaded. Timbreens are stiff and affect your truck when it's unloaded a lot more than the SumoSprings. If this were me, I would go with the SumoSprings because it will give me a better ride quality when not under load.
